Job Description
Job Description
Salary :
The career youve always wanted starts here.
This is your chance to work in a place that is making a positive difference for SMBs across Canada. Where teamwork, flexibility, and professional growth are encouraged every step of the way.
Ready to take your career to a whole new level? Journey Capital is here to get you there.
Not your average fintech company
As Canadas leading online lender, Journey Capital is dedicated to helping clients with a collaborative, adaptive, and customer-centric approach. We are setting new benchmarks in the industry by embracing innovation, transparency, and ethical lending standards.
About the opportunity
As a Senior Salesforce Developer , you will play a key role in developing and maintaining Salesforce solutions, with a focus on Sales Cloud and Lightning Web Components (LWC). You will collaborate with business and technical teams to enhance system functionality, develop custom features, and ensure seamless integrations with other platforms. Your expertise will help drive efficiency, scalability, and maintainability across our Salesforce environment.
Responsibilities
- Develop, maintain, and optimize Salesforce applications using Apex (Triggers, Async, Batch), Visualforce, and Lightning Web Components (LWC).
- Work with Legacy Code to refactor and implement scalable solutions following OOP, SOLID, and Clean Code Principles.
- Design and implement unit tests to ensure high code quality and system stability.
- Develop and maintain SOQL queries, optimizing for performance and concurrency where applicable.
- Build and maintain integrations between Salesforce and internal / external systems using HTTP / REST APIs and SOAP.
- Utilize Version Control (Git), working with Pull Requests (PRs) and collaborating in a structured development workflow.
- Work with VS Code and Salesforce DX to manage and deploy changes efficiently.
- Configure and customize Salesforce Administration settings, including security models, profiles, and permission sets.
- Leverage design patterns (GoF) to create scalable and reusable components.Participate in package development and modularize solutions for deployment across multiple environments.
- Support Sales Cloud enhancements and collaborate on Experience Cloud projects.
- Participate in package development and modularize solutions for deployment across multiple environments,
What youre bringing to the table
The Perks :
Empowering Canadian entrepreneurs
We deliver a seamless remote experience that gives our clients the peace of mind to move their business forward. We aim to equip underserved Canadian entrepreneurs with the right credit, tools, and experience to help them reach their financial objectives fast.
Sound like something youd be interested in? Lets talk.
Journey Capital
Here to get you there.
Vous devez être connecté pour pouvoir ajouter un emploi aux favoris
Connexion ou Créez un compte